Classes begin once yearly in September. The class days are specific to the year students begin; even-numbered years meet on Monday and Tuesday, while odd-numbered years meet on Thursday and Friday.

For the class starting in September 2009, the class days are Thursday and Friday plus one weekend a month (Saturday and Sunday). There are no weekend intensives in Level III of the program. Midway through each trimester, students receive a reading week. During this week no classes will be held, to give students more time to reflect on their coursework. In addition to the class days, students will be expected to allocate 15 to 20 hours per week for outside study. The program also includes a maximum of two multi-day out-of-state field trips, occasional off-campus classes and intensives.

The course is a full-time program averaging 28 to 32 months, depending on the pace you set while completing Level III in the program. The maximum amount of time allowed to complete the program is 60 months.
